Arne Slot has spoken out about Liverpool's transfer plans for the January window, giving fans insight into the club's strategy.

Sitting at the top of both the Premier League and UEFA Champions League tables, the Reds are in a strong position as they chase silverware on multiple fronts. But with a packed schedule ahead, fans are eager to know if reinforcements are on the way.

During a press conference this week, Slot addressed the speculation. While he didn't completely rule out the possibility of new signings, he made it clear that Liverpool are satisfied with the current squad.

"It would be a bit weird if I said we were very happy with the team in the summer and now say something different," Slot said.

Arne Slot on Liverpool's January transfer plans

Slot emphasized his belief in the players he already has at his disposal, highlighting their impressive performances during the first half of the season.

He noted that the team is largely injury-free, with the exception of Joe Gomez, who is recovering and expected back in a few weeks.

Despite being happy with his squad, Slot admitted that Liverpool always keep an eye on the transfer market.

He pointed to the club's signing of Giorgi Mamardashvili, even though the goalkeeper was loaned back to Valencia after agreeing his transfer. "This club always tries to bring in opportunities when they arise," he added.

The Reds' busy schedule, which includes a Carabao Cup semifinal against Spurs and an FA Cup clash against Accrington Stanley, could test the depth of the squad.

However, Slot expressed confidence in the players' ability to handle the challenges ahead.
